BASIC OVERVIEW
The Fleeing Artists Theatre are producing staged readings of four original, never-before-seen plays, written by local and regional playwrights. For this set of performances, we are performing these two plays: "Beauty of Psyche" by JJ Gatesman, and "In Lieu of Flowers" by Katherine Beeson.
"Beauty of Psyche" PLAY DESCRIPTION
The story centers around the original myth that inspired Beauty and the Beast. After being cast out of her village, Psyche finds herself rescued by an enchanting stranger. Psyche must use her wits to connect with her captor and find her way to true freedom. Themes of responsibility, love, and family all shine through this magical mini-epic. Directed by EDSON MELENDEZ.
"In Lieu of Flowers" PLAY DESCRIPTION
A charming story about the importance of family. Set in the Chatterbox Cafe, longtime owner Lou passes away unexpectedly, leaving his business in the hands of longtime waitress Fran Klein. But, there's a twist: Fran must co-own and co-run the cafe with newcomer Joan Borden for an extended period of time, a woman whom Fran has never met and whose first appearance was at Lou's funeral. Directed by ALEX METALSKY.
